DESCRIPTION
This team enables automation at Amazon Robotics Fulfillment centers. This team serves Amazon Internal Fulfillment Technologies & Robotics teams by enabling automation, which includes real-time & offline (image/video) data auditing services. One of the key contributions of this team is supporting the fulfillment centers in maintaining inventory accuracy.An Associate in this role is required to watch the video of the stowing action at a fulfillment center, understand it thoroughly and make best use of human judgement in combination with the tools and resources to indicate the activity captured in the video. They are expected to verify or mark the location of product through a tool while maintaining highest level of accuracy. This process helps in maintaining the fulfillment center's stow quality. This is an operational role. Under general supervision, the Associate performs precise and thorough video/image audits with high degree of accuracy and speed, thus aiding defect reduction.

A day in the life
Associates work in 24x7 environment with rotational shifts. Associates would be working in a 9 hour shift, including pre-scheduled breaks. The shift timings would be subject to change every 3-4 months or as per business requirement. In case associate is working in night shift, night shift allowance will be provided as per applicable Amazon’s work policy.
Weekly Offs: Rotational two-consecutive day off (it is a 5-day working week with 2 consecutive days off, not necessarily Saturday and Sunday) or as per business discretion.
About the team
Data Auditing Operations team provides human support to Amazon Fulfillment facilities with goal of enabling hands-free active stowing through visual audits on videos/images. Videos with brief duration (typically between 15 and 20seconds) are sent to Operations Team for humans to audit them with information on products being stored at fulfilment centers. For business use, these videos must be thoroughly reviewed and audited using best human judgement. The effectiveness of automated process will be increased by using videos that Associates have audited. This process helps maintaining stow quality at fulfillment center and Associate will be further evaluated for performance improvements/coaching
